基于SOA架构的口岸电子闸口系统的设计与实现

摘要: 针对当前软件系统开发中业务需求的多变性和复杂性,引入面向服务体系结构(SOA)的框架设计,并结合一个口岸电子闸口系统实例,介绍业务流程执行引擎的结构,详细说明用SOA的架构设计,使该口岸电子闸口系统具备良好的系统扩展延伸条件。

关键词: SOA, Web Services, MQ通信, 报文

Abstract: Aiming at the variability and complexity of business demand in the current software system development, this paper introduces a service-oriented architecture (SOA) framework for the design, and takes a port electronic gate system as an example, introduces the business process execution engine structure, a detailed description of the SOA structure design. The port electronic gate system is of good extension condition.

Key words: SOA, Web Services, MQ communication, message
